It's an onomatopoeia, a word that substitutes a sound. While most cultures have onomatopoeia for sounds like a dogs bark (woof/wan), a cats caterwaul (meow/nyaa), or a heartbeat (lub-dub/be-bump/doki-doki). Japanese have onomatopoeia for silent actions. Jii is the "sound" of a stare.

Using verbs as onomatopoeia is common in manga for a couple of reasons.
First, they can evoke sounds without actually trying to create nonsense words that emulate the sound (like BLAM, SNIKT, WHAP, onomatopoeia in western comics)
Secondly, they can convey action that may not be easily communicated in a single panel. What's the difference between a character with their eyes open between blinks and a stare? How do you represent that without multiple panels displaying the state of their eyes? Use a sound-effect verb.
Anime directors often make this verb visible as characters in anime, or simply voice the word and use it as audio since that option is now available in the medium.
